Where can I find sentencing results for Medway County Court and Family Court?

CauseAlert shows scheduled hearings, including cases listed "for Sentence". However, outcomes and sentencing remarks are not published through HMCTS cause lists. For sentencing results, check the Judiciary website (judiciary.uk) for sentencing remarks, or local news coverage.

Are court records at Medway County Court and Family Court public?

Daily cause lists published by HMCTS are public documents. CauseAlert mirrors every published listing for Medway County Court and Family Court. For historical case records beyond cause lists, contact the court directly or search court judgments on the National Archives.
